== History: == The PXD formats were first supported by Blender scripts created by Turk645. These initial scripts allowed animation and skeleton importing for the files first found in the 2020 Olympic game. From Origins onward, animation data was identified by ik-01 to be compressed by [https://github.com/nfrechette/acl ACL]. An application called "FrontiersAnimDecompress" was later created by WistfulHopes, which was used to dump decompressed track data (labeled as *.outanim files) from these newly compressed formats. Included with the app were supplemental Blender scripts for importing from the dumped track data (modified from Turk645's original scripts), as well as custom scripts for exporting custom skeletons and raw track data that could later be recompressed. The application was eventually modified into a DLL, and supplemental scripts were rewritten as one packaged add-on by AdelQue, so standalone conversion was no longer necessary. Notable additions included batch processing, corrected scaling, skeleton reorientation for mirror support, and root motion. Handling of raw track data was recently found to be identical across all Hedgehog Engine titles. The method in this add-on to achieve correct scaling can be reused for other Hedgehog Engine games stored in [[Resources/Havok Animation|Havok animation]] formats.
